NWAC Softball

Undefeated Red Devils make history

The LCC softball teams poses for a photo after clinching the NWAC South Region championship with a sweep over Grays Harbor on Friday, May 2, at Tam O’ Shanter Park. The Red Devils also set a new school record for consecutive victories. / Photo courtesy of LCC Athletics

Clinching the NWAC South Region title in Friday's softball opener with Grays Harbor was only part of the fun as the Lower Columbia College Red Devils also set a team record for consecutive victories during their romp at Tam O'Shanter Park.

LCC bettered the old mark of 38 straight wins set in 2002 by taking the opener over the Chokers 8-0, and extended the win skein to 40 victories with a 15-2 drubbing in the nightcap.

In 2002, the Red Devils lost their fourth game of the season, and bounced back to roll-off 38 straight victories en route to the NWAC Championship and a 41-1 record.
